Table 8. Terms, symbols, and units. SI base units are used, except for the liter [L = dm3]. SI refers to ref. [11].
Term | Link to MitoPedia term | Symbol | Unit | Links and comments |
---|---|---|---|---|
alternative quinol oxidase] | Alternative oxidase | AOX | - | Fig. 1B |
adenosine monophosphate | AMP | AMP | - | 2 ADP ↔ ATP+AMP |
adenosine diphosphate | ADP | ADP | - | Tab. 1; Fig. 1, 2, 5 |
adenosine triphosphate | ATP | ATP | - | Fig. 2, 5 |
adenylates | Adenylates | AMP, ADP, ATP | - | Section 2.5.1 |
amount of substance X | Amount | nX or n(X) | [mol] | SI |
ATP yield per O2 | ATP yield | YP»/O2 | 1 | P»/O2 ratio measured in any respiratory state |
catabolic reaction | Respiration | k | - | Fig. 1, 3 |
catabolic rate of respiration | Respiration | JkO2; IkO2 | varies | Fig. 1, 3; see flux J and flow I |
cell count | Count | Nce | [x] | Tab. 4; Fig. 5; see number of cells |
cell mass | Mass | mce | [kg] | Tab. 5; Fig. 5 |
cell mass, mass per cell | Mass | MNce | [kg∙x-1] | Tab. 5; Fig. 5 |
cell-mass concentration | Concentration | Cmce | [kg∙L-1] | see Cms: Tab. 4; Cmce = mce∙V-1 |
cell-count concentration | Concentration | Cce | [x∙L-1] | Tab. 4; Cce = Nce∙V-1 |
cell viability index | Cell viability | VI | - | VI = Nvce∙Nce-1 = 1 - Ndce∙Nce-1 |
charge number of entity B | Charge number | zB | 1 | Tab. 6; zO2 = 4 [[[Cohen 2008 IUPAC Green Book |24]]] |
Complexes I to IV | Complex I | CI to CIV | - | respiratory ET Complexes are redox proton pumps; Fig. 1B; F1FO-ATPase is not a redox proton pump of the ETS, hence the term CV is not recommended |
concentration of X, count | Concentration | CX = NX∙V-1 | [x∙L-1] | Tab. 4 (number concentration [[[Cohen 2008 IUPAC Green Book |24]]]) |
concentration of B, amount | Concentration | cB = NB∙V-1 | [mol∙L-1] | SI: amount of substance concentration [[[Cohen 2008 IUPAC Green Book |24]]] |
concentration of O2, amount | Concentration | cO2 = nO2∙V-1 | [mol∙L-1] | Box 2; [O2] |
count format | Format | N | [x] | Tab. 4, 5; Fig. 5 |
count of X | Count | NX | [x] | SI; see number of entities X |
coupling control state | Coupling control state | CCS | - | Section 2.4.1 |
dead cells | Cell viability | dce | - | Tab. 5 |
electrical format | Format | e | [C] | Tab. 6 |
electron transfer, state | Electron transfer pathway | ET | - | Tab. 1; Fig. 2B, 4 (State 3u) |
electron transfer system | Electron transfer pathway | ETS | - | Fig. 2B, 4 (electron transport chain) |
entity | Entity | X | [x] | single countable object; Tab. 4 |
ET capacity | ET capacity | E | varies | rate; Tab. 1; Fig. 2 |
ET-excess capacity | ET capacity | E-P | varies | Fig. 2 |
flow, for O2 | Flow | IO2 | [mol∙s-1] | system-related extensive quantity; Fig. 5 |
flux, for O2 | Flux | JO2 | varies | size-specific quantity; Fig. 5 |
inorganic phosphate | Phosphate | Pi | - | Fig. 1C |
inorganic phosphate carrier | Phosphate carrier | PiC | - | Fig. 1C |
isolated mitochondria | Isolated mitochondria | imt | - | Tab. 5 |
living cells | Living cells | ce | - | Tab. 5 (intact cells) |
LEAK-state | LEAK-state | LEAK | - | Tab. 1; Fig. 2 (compare State 4) |
LEAK respiration | LEAK respiration | L | varies | rate; Tab. 1; Fig. 2 |
mass concentration of sample s | Concentration | Cms | [kg∙L-1] | Tab. 4 |
mass format | Format | m | [kg] | Tab. 4 |
mass of diluted sample | Mass | ms | [kg] | SI: mass of pure sample mS |
mass per single object | Mass | MNX | [kg∙x1] | Fig. 5; Tab. 4; SI: m(X); compare molar mass M(X) |
mass, dry mass | Mass | md | [kg] | Fig. 5 (dry weight) |
mass, wet mass | Mass | mw | [kg] | Fig. 5 (wet weight) |

mitochondria or mitochondrial | Mitochondria | mt | - | Box 1 |
mitochondrial DNA | Mitochondria | mtDNA | - | Box 1 |
mitochondrial concentration | Concentration | CmtE = mtE∙V-1 | [mtEU∙L-1] | Tab. 4 |
mitochondrial content | Mitochondria | mtENX | [mtEU∙x-1] | mtENX = mtE∙NX-1; Tab. 4 |
mitochondrial density | Density | DmtE=mtE∙ms-1 | [mtEU∙kg-1] | tissue-mass specific mt-density; Tab. 4 |
mitochondrial elementary marker | Mitochondria | mtE | [mtEU] | quantity of mt-marker; Tab. 4 |
mitochondrial elementary unit | Mitochondria | mtEU | varies | specific units for mt-marker; Tab. 4 |
mitochondrial inner membrane | Mitochondrial inner membrane | mtIM | - | Fig. 1; Box 1 (MIM) |
mitochondrial outer membrane | Mitochondrial outer membrane | mtOM | - | Fig. 1; Box 1 (MIM) |
mitochondrial recovery | Mitochondrial recovery | YmtE | 1 | fraction of mtE recovered from the tissue sample in imt-stock |
mitochondrial yield | Mitochondrial yield | YmtE/ms | [mtEU∙kg-1] | mt-yield in imt-stock per mass of tissue sample; YmtE/ms=YmtE∙DmtE |
molar format | Format | n | [mol] | Tab. 6 |
molar mass | Molar mass | MB | [kg∙mol-1] | compare MNB [kg∙x-1]; SI M(X) |
negative | Protonmotive force | neg | - | Fig. 4 |
number of cells | Count | Nce | [x] | total cell count of living cells, Nce = Nvce + Ndce; Tab. 4, 5 |
number of dead cells | Cell viability | Ndce | [x] | non-viable cell count, loss of plasma membrane barrier function; Tab. 5 |
number of entities B | Count | NB | [x] | Tab. 4 [[[Cohen 2008 IUPAC Green Book |24]]] |
number of entities X; count | Count | NX | [x] | ‘count’ is an SI quantity [11], but the counting unit [x] is not in the SI [95]; Tab. 4; Fig. 5 |
number of viable cells | Cell viability | Nvce | [x] | viable cell count, intact plasma membrane barrier function; Tab. 5 |
organisms | Organism | org | - | Tab. 5 |
oxidative phosphorylation | Oxidative phosphorylation | OXPHOS | - | Tab. 1 |
OXPHOS-state | OXPHOS-state | OXPHOS | - | Tab. 1; Fig. 2; OXPHOS-state distinguished from the process OXPHOS (State 3 at kinetically-saturating [ADP] and [Pi]) |
OXPHOS capacity | OXPHOS capacity | P | varies | rate; Tab. 1; Fig. 2 |
oxygen concentration | Oxygen concentration | cO2 = nO2∙V-1 | [mol∙L-1] | [O2]; Section 3.2 |
oxygen flux, in reaction r | Oxygen flux | JrO2 | varies | Overview |
pathway control state | Pathway control state | PCS | - | Section 2.2 |
permeability transition | Permeability transition | mtPT | - | Fig. 3; Section 2.4.3 (MPT) |
permeabilized cells | Permeabilized cells | pce | - | experimental permeabilization of plasma membrane; Tab. 5 |
permeabilized muscle fibers | Permeabilized muscle fibers | pfi | - | Tab. 5 |
permeabilized tissue | Permeabilized tissue | pti | - | Tab. 5 |
phosphorylation of ADP to ATP | Oxidative phosphorylation | P» | - | Tab. 1, 2; Fig. 1, 4 |
P»/O2 ratio | Oxidative phosphorylation | P»/O2 | 1 | mechanistic YP»/O2, calculated from pump stoichiometries; Fig. 1c |
positive | positive | Protonmotive force | - | Fig. 4 |
proton in the neg compartment | Protonmotive force | H+neg | [x] | Fig. 4 |
proton in the pos compartment | proton in the positive compartment | H+pos | [x] | Fig. 4 |
protonmotive force | protonmotive force | pmF | [V] | Overview; Tab. 1; Fig 1a, 2, 4 |
rate in ET-state | Electron transfer pathway | E | varies | ET capacity; Tab. 1; Fig. 2, 4 |
rate in LEAK-state | LEAK | L | varies | Tab. 1: L(n), L(T), L(Omy); Fig. 2, 4 |
rate in OXPHOS-state | OXPHOS | P | varies | OXPHOS capacity; Tab.1; Fig. 2, 4 |
rate in ROX state | Residual oxygen consumption | Rox | varies | Overview; Tab. 1 |
residual oxygen consumption | Residual oxygen consumption | ROX; Rox | - | state ROX; rate Rox; Tab. 1 |
respiration | Respiration | JrO2 | varies | rate of reaction r; Overview |
respiratory supercomplex | Supercomplex | SCInIIInIVn | - | supramolecular assemblies with variable copy numbers (n) of CI, CIII and CIV; Box 1 |
sample | Sample | s | - | diluted sample; Tab. 4, 5 |
substrate concentration at half-maximal rate | Concentration | c50 | [mol∙L-1] | Section 2.1.2 |
substrate-uncoupler-inhibitor-titration | Substrate-uncoupler-inhibitor-titration | SUIT | - | Section 2.2 |
tissue homogenate | Tissue homogenate | thom | - | Tab. 5 |
viable cells | Viable cells | vce | - | Tab. 5 |
volume of chamber | Volume | V | [L] | Tab. 4, 7; Fig. 5 |
volume format | Format | V | [L] | Tab. 6 |
volume of sample s | Volume | Vs | [L] | Tab. 5; Fig. 5 |
